> GossipRouter supports both NIO (ByteBuffer) and TCP (stream-based) connections. In both cases, however, the entire message is read and then routed to the destination address.
> It would be better to only read the cluster name and target address, and then use efficient stream-to-stream (or channel-to-channel) _transfer mechanisms_, which avoids temporary copies of data and the full reading of messages.
> Also look into routing of entire message _batches_.
> Investigate whether this is possible.

> When multiple new members are started concurrently, and no coord is present yet, different clients get different discovery results, and this may lead to merging.
> If we have no coord, we could run the discovery protocol multiple time, *with the current members list being cached*, and then might end up with a more similar list of new members.
> This could be governed by an additional attribute in {{Discovery}} ({{num_discovery_runs}}?)
